Fayetteville Turf Conditions

Fayette County's clay-heavy soil is honestly the biggest reason artificial turf makes sense here. Clay doesn't drain like sandy soil, which means water pools and creates those dead patches or slippery spots—especially frustrating on larger suburban lots where you can't easily amend everything. Our installation process accounts for this: we build in proper drainage layers beneath the synthetic grass so Fayetteville's humidity doesn't create problems underneath. Raised-bed borders are ideal for Fayetteville properties because they let you establish vegetable gardens, shrub plantings, or decorative beds without competing with the turf installation. Most residential yards in Whitewater and Kenwood run 5,000 to 10,000 square feet of usable lawn, which makes the ROI on artificial turf substantial—you're eliminating weekly mowing, fertilizer costs, and seasonal treatments that clay soil demands. Sun exposure varies by neighborhood; south-facing yards get intense afternoon heat, while tree-lined properties in Kenwood often deal with shade. We specify UV-stable turf grades and pile heights that perform in both conditions.

How does Fayette County's clay soil affect artificial turf installation?

Clay drains slowly and compacts easily, which is why proper drainage layers matter during installation. We add a perforated base that prevents water from pooling beneath the turf—critical in Fayetteville's humid summers. Without this step, clay creates a moisture trap under synthetic grass. Our process accounts for this specific soil type.

Can I install artificial turf myself on my Fayetteville property?

DIY installation on clay soil typically fails because you need excavation equipment to remove old sod, proper compaction techniques, and precise drainage grading. Fayetteville's terrain and clay composition require professional assessment. We handle site prep, grading, and seaming—details that are easy to underestimate on clay lots.
